Replace or Clean Air Filters

One of the simplest yet most important maintenance tasks is checking your HVAC air filter.

Over time, filters collect dust, pet dander, pollen, and other airborne particles.

When a filter becomes clogged, airflow is restricted, forcing your air conditioning system to work harder than necessary.

Replacing or cleaning filters regularly can improve efficiency, enhance indoor air quality, and help your system cool your home more effectively.

Most homeowners should inspect their filters at least once a month during peak cooling season.

Clear Debris Around Outdoor Units

Your outdoor condenser unit needs adequate airflow to operate properly.

During the spring months, leaves, grass clippings, branches, and other debris can accumulate around the equipment.

Take time to clear the area surrounding the unit and trim back any vegetation that may be growing too close.

Maintaining at least a few feet of clearance around the condenser allows air to circulate freely and helps maximize cooling performance.

Check Your Thermostat Settings

Before summer temperatures arrive, test your thermostat to ensure it is functioning correctly.

If your thermostat is outdated, upgrading to a programmable or smart model can help improve energy efficiency.

Smart thermostats allow homeowners to create customized schedules that automatically adjust temperatures based on occupancy patterns.

This can help reduce cooling costs while maintaining comfort throughout the day.

Inspect Vents and Registers

Blocked vents can make it difficult for cool air to circulate throughout your home.

Walk through each room and make sure furniture, curtains, rugs, or other items are not obstructing airflow.

Open all supply and return vents to promote balanced air distribution.

Proper airflow helps your cooling system operate more efficiently and can reduce hot spots in different areas of the home.

Seal Air Leaks

Even the most efficient air conditioner can struggle if cooled air is escaping through gaps around windows and doors.

Check for drafts and seal any visible openings with weatherstripping or caulk.

Improving your home’s insulation and sealing air leaks can help keep conditioned air indoors, reducing strain on your cooling system and lowering energy bills.

Schedule Professional Maintenance

Routine professional maintenance remains one of the best ways to prepare for peak cooling season.

During a maintenance visit, technicians can inspect system components, clean critical parts, check refrigerant levels, and identify potential issues before they lead to costly repairs.

Preventative maintenance often helps extend equipment lifespan while reducing the likelihood of unexpected breakdowns during periods of heavy use.
